Factors Affecting Cost
- Size of the Slab: Larger slabs require more materials and labor, increasing the overall cost.
- Thickness of the Slab: Thicker slabs need more concrete, which can drive up expenses.
- Type of Concrete: Specialized concrete mixes, such as high-strength or decorative concrete, can be more expensive.
- Removal of Old Concrete: The cost of demolishing and disposing of the old slab adds to the total expense.
- Labor Costs: Labor rates in San Antonio can vary, affecting the overall price.
- Site Preparation: Grading, leveling, and other preparatory work can increase costs.
- Permits and Inspections: Local regulations may require permits and inspections, adding to the expense.
- Accessibility of the Site: Hard-to-reach areas may require additional equipment or labor, increasing costs.
Average Costs for Common Tasks
Task | Average Cost in San Antonio, TX |
---|---|
Concrete Slab Removal | $500 - $1,500 |
New Concrete Slab Installation | $6 - $10 per sq. ft. |
Site Preparation | $1,000 - $3,000 |
Permits and Inspections | $100 - $500 |
Decorative Concrete | $10 - $15 per sq. ft. |
Reinforced Concrete | $9 - $12 per sq. ft. |
